Former Governor of Abia state, Dr Orji Uzor Kalu, while speaking with 
airport correspondents yesterday as he returned from a trip to the UK, 
said if things are not properly checked politically, President 
Jonathan might be the last president Nigeria will have. 
"When I was travelling precisely on the 26 of April, I left this airport
 and I spoke to the airport correspondents and I said there was a need 
to collaborate with international organisations. You see, this 
issue is not about President Goodluck Jonathan. If we don’t take time 
and work together as Nigerians, Jonathan might be the last Nigerian 
President. Jonathan might be the Gorbachev of Nigeria. And that is the 
truth, so we better wake up. Political class, business class, military, 
civilians must now stand up to work for our internal security. Internal
 security is more important than anything we have done and I believe 
that once we are able to come together Nigeria will be alright. As of 
now the country is in pains; the country is in problem and some people 
are taking it very lightly. 
We
 are suffering from pains of our people; we are suffering from pains of 
the Nigerian system. This is not about which part of the country you 
come from, it is about Nigeria. Nigerian people should take what 
is happening seriously and I am surprised that the political class and 
the private sector are still joking with this matter. This is a 
serious matter. Anybody’s child can be kidnapped; whether it is at 
Chibok or any other place, Nigerian should take this matter seriously. 
Can you imagine how many Nigerians that have been killed; how many of us
 that have been wounded. I want people to be as wise as my grandmother. 
 I want people to take this matter seriously. Those girls 
kidnapped are our sisters; they are our daughters. It is because none of
 us has lost anybody that is why to some people; it is looking like a 
joke. We should stop taking this as a joke and take the matter very 
seriously in order to move forward.
We
 should not lose what we have. We should be able to come together as one
 family and fight because if we don’t take time; I repeat it for the 
second time, Jonathan will be the last president of the name Nigeria. Government
 can negotiate formerly or informally. It can send agents to negotiate 
on its behalf without getting involved. The US does this in Afghanistan 
and other places. It can negotiate formerly or informally” he said
